From e59572e94018513caac0209f27b375eaf2b63fd1 Mon Sep 17 00:00:00 2001 From: Miguel Barro Date: Tue, 5 Jul 2022 15:34:31 +0200 Subject: [PATCH] Refs 14681. Fixing WriterProxyData clear() method Signed-off-by: Miguel Barro --- src/cpp/rtps/builtin/data/WriterProxyData.cpp |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/cpp/rtps/builtin/data/WriterProxyData.cpp b/src/cpp/rtps/builtin/data/WriterProxyData.cpp index 824971d2855..ebef33e3cd1 100644 --- a/src/cpp/rtps/builtin/data/WriterProxyData.cpp +++ b/src/cpp/rtps/builtin/data/WriterProxyData.cpp @@ -1023,6 +1023,10 @@ bool WriterProxyData::readFromCDRMessage( void WriterProxyData::clear() { +#if HAVE_SECURITY + security_attributes_ = 0UL; + plugin_security_attributes_ = 0UL; +#endif // if HAVE_SECURITY m_guid = c_Guid_Unknown; remote_locators_.unicast.clear(); remote_locators_.multicast.clear();